Let’s not sugarcoat it, the Utah Jazz have a lot of issues right now. And there’s simply no easy fix for it, or one quick move they can make. They need to get this roster clicking, rediscover their offense and get their focus back on defense if they’re going to amount to anything this year.
Among the many issues they have is a definite lack of size down low. When they traded away Derrick Favors to create space for Bojan Bogdanovic and the prolific offense he would bring, the front office knew full well this could be an issue.
